Revision as of 17:24, 19 September 2010

Limited Edition Cover
Regular Edition Cover
Artist
moumoon
Single
Tiny Star
Released
2008.06.04
Catalog Number
AVCD-31427/B (Limited Edition)
AVCD-31428 (Regular Edition & TSUTAYA RECORDS)
Price
¥1,890 (Limited Edition & TSUTAYA RECORDS)
¥1,050 (Regular Edition)
CD Tracklist
  1. Tiny Star
  2. Kokoro no Shizuku (こころのしずく; Drops Of A Heart)
  3. Do you remember? ~English ver.~
  4. Sunrise (TSUTAYA RECORDS Only)
  5. Tiny Star (Instrumental)
  6. Kokoro no Shizuku (Instrumental) (こころのしずく)
DVD Tracklist
  1. Tiny Star (PV)
  2. FULLMOON LIVE (Live Footage)


Information

"Tiny Star" is moumoon's third single (second major label single). The main track was used as the ending theme and as the CM song for the Namco game 99 no Namida. "Kokoro no Shizuku" was used as the opening theme song for the same game. The limited edition contains live-footage of the FULLMOON LIVE of 2.21 at Shibuya Eggman. It reached #47 on the Oricon charts and charted for three weeks.
